Apocalypto by horner james soundtrack James horner biography Forest horner james once upon James horner Apocalypto by horner james soundtrack James horner alien James horner music James horner soundtrack James horner soundtrack Apocalypto by horner james soundtrack Horner james mp willow Titanic james horner Titanic james horner James horner alien James horner mp James horner troy James horner alien James horner alien James horner James horner biography Apocalypto by horner james soundtrack James horner music Forest horner james once upon James horner mp Apocalypto by horner james soundtrack James horner soundtrack James horner mp Horner james mp willow James horner music James horner mp James horner troy James horner rose James horner James horner rose James horner biography Apocalypto by horner james soundtrack James horner mp James horner troy